Health Concerns
There is a great deal of
debate over the human health risk posed by pesticides. Clearly, pesticides are
by their very nature designed to kill, and if improperly used, can be acutely
toxic to humans. However, the long-term effects of low-level exposure to pesticides
in the home, and the environment, is less well understood. What is known is
that many common pesticides have been linked to reproductive problems and the
formation of cancers in other species.
